Why National Dental Care Month Matters!
National Dental Care Month serves as a helpful reminder to prioritize your oral health. Poor hygiene can lead to infections, tooth loss, or systemic health issues like heart disease. For denture and implant patients, consistent care prevents complications like gum inflammation or implant failure. Gum disease is a common cause of missing teeth, possibly indicating a lack of awareness about dental health. Oral Hygiene Tips for Everyone
Good oral hygiene starts with basic practices that apply to everyone:
- Brush twice daily – Use a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ste. Avoid overbrushing, which can damage your gums and erode tooth enamel.
- Floss daily – Clean between teeth where brushes can’t reach.
- Stay hydrated – Drinking water helps wash away food particles and bacteria.
- Limit sugary foods and drinks – Sugar feeds harmful bacteria in your mouth.
- Schedule regular dental checkups – Professional cleanings catch problems early.
Specialized Care for Denture Wearers Near Glendale, AZ
Denture maintenance requires special attention to keep both the prosthetic and your oral health in good shape:
Daily Denture Care Tips:
- Remove and rinse after eating – Clear away food particles with water.
- Clean your mouth after removing dentures – Use a soft toothbrush on gums, tongue, and palate. Gently brushing your gums stimulates circulation.
- Brush dentures daily – Use a non-abrasive denture cleaner and soft brush.
- Soak dentures overnight – Most dentures need to stay moist to maintain their shape.
- Rinse thoroughly before reinserting – Especially if using denture solution.
Common Denture Challenges:
- Fit changes – Your mouth naturally changes over time, affecting how dentures fit.
- Soreness – Ill-fitting dentures can cause discomfort and sores, potentially leading to worse problems down the line.
- Speaking difficulties – New dentures sometimes affect speech patterns.

Dental Implant Maintenance in Sun City West
Dental implants offer a long-lasting solution that closely mimics natural teeth, but they still require proper implant care:
Dental Implant Care Best Practices:
- Brush twice daily – Use a soft-bristled toothbrush specifically designed for implants.
- Floss carefully around implants – Special floss or interdental brushes work best.
- Use low-abrasive toothpaste – Avoid products that can scratch implant surfaces.
- Consider water flossers – Water flossers, like the Waterpik, can clean hard-to-reach areas around implants.
- Avoid hard foods – Excessive force can damage implant restorations.

Signs Your Dental Implant Needs Attention:
- Pain or discomfort – Properly healed implants shouldn’t cause pain.
- Visible inflammation – Redness around dental implants may indicate infection.
- Difficulty chewing – Changes in bite or chewing ability need assessment.
- Loose implant – Any movement requires immediate professional attention.
